Suntory Beverage & Food (SBF) reports H1 2026 results on August 6, 2026. Q1 2026 (January–March) alone delivered ¥406.9 billion (+11.2% YoY; +6.1% currency-neutral). For H1 ≥ ¥820 billion, Q2 revenue needs only to reach ~¥413 billion. Since Q2 (April–June) is the peak season for Japanese beverages (Boss Coffee, Pepsi Japan, Suntory The Premium Malt's), Q2 typically exceeds Q1. The strong growth momentum from Q1 and a weak yen (FX tailwind on overseas revenues from Europe/Oceania) support the estimate. No Polymarket market.
